About the City
The city consists of approximately 24 square miles, with much of the area lying between Lake
Griffin to the north and Lake Harris to the south. Hundreds of smaller lakes and ponds dot the
local landscape. Located in sunny Central Florida, midway between the Atlantic Ocean and the
Gulf of Mexico, Leesburg is situated just 80 miles northeast of Tampa, 70 miles southwest of
Daytona Beach, and 40 northwest of Orlando. The City sits at the crossroads of U.S. Highway 441,
U.S. Highway 27, and State Road 44.
